| Hi, I've successfully installed Windows Vista Beta2 with an "Ultimate" Product-Key on a VMWare 5.5 virtual machine. Everything goes fine, but i'd like to uninstall the terminal services, which are installed by default. I haven't figure out a way to do so. In Windows Server 2003 i can go to Add/Remove programs in the control panel and then uninstall TS from Windows Components, but in Vista, under "Turn Windows Vista features On/Off" there isn't the option for TS. Is it possibile to uninstall or disable the terminal services on the Ultimate edition of Vista? I have to test some applications on Vista, but these apps requires the terminal services to be disabled (and to check the presence of TS, these apps rely on the registry key HKLM\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\ProductOptio ns for the string "Terminal Server"; if i manually change this value with regedit, Windows automatically restores it) | Guest
